Dosing: Adult Antimicrobial Dosing, Non-dialysis
Indication | CrCl >120 mL/min | 60-119 mL/min | 30-59 mL/min | 15-29 mL/min | <15 mL/min |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
All Indications | 2 g IV q6h infused over 3 hours | 2 g IV q8h infused over 3 hours | 1.5 g IV q8h infused over 3 hours | 1 g IV q8h infused over 3 hours | 750 mg IV q12h infused over 3 hours |
Dosing: Antimicrobial Dosing in Intermittent & Continuous Hemodialysis
Indication |
Intermittent Hemodialysis |
Continuous Hemodialysis |
---|---|---|
All Indications | 750 mg IV q12h over 3 hours |
*Effluent flow rate 2 L/hr or less: 1.5 g IV every 12 hours over 3 hours *Effluent flow rate 2.1 - 3 L/hr: 2 g IV every 12 hours over 3 hours *Effluent flow rate 3.1 - 4 L/hr: 1.5 g IV every 8 hours over 3 hours *Effluent flow rate > 4 L/hr: 2 g IV every 8 hours over 3 hours |
